Strong Ultrasonic Plastic Welding Technology
Ultrasonic plastic welding represents a highly effective joining method for diverse thermoplastic materials. This technique leverages high-frequency ultrasonic vibrations to produce friction between the surfaces of joined plastic parts, resulting in a durable bond. The process delivers several benefits, including limited heat input, which helps to protect the integrity of the materials and eliminate the risk of warping or discoloration. Furthermore, ultrasonic welding allows high-speed production and refined control over the joint quality.
